The Rise of Immersive Experiences
Forget clunky interfaces and static screens. The future of online casinos is all about immersion. Think vir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) transforming the way you play. Imagine sitting at a virtual poker table, surrounded by other players, with the ability to see their tells and interact in real-time. Or picture yourself exploring a virtual casino floor, complete with dazzling lights, realistic sound effects, and the buzz of a live environment. This level of immersion isn’t just about flashy graphics; it’s about creating a more engaging and social experience. VR and AR are still in their early stages, but the potential is enormous. Expect to see more casinos investing in these technologies, offering players a truly unique and captivating way to gamble.
Live Dealer Games: The Evolution Continues
Live dealer games have already revolutionized the online casino landscape, bringing the authenticity of a brick-and-mortar casino directly to your screen. But the evolution isn’t stopping there. Expect to see even more sophisticated live dealer experiences, with higher-quality video streams, more interactive features, and a wider variety of games. Think multi-camera angles, personalized dealer interactions, and even the ability to tip your dealer directly. The goal is to blur the lines between the online and offline worlds, creating a seamless and engaging experience that caters to the social aspects of gambling.
The Impact of Mobile Gaming
Mobile gaming is no longer a trend; it’s the dominant force in the online casino world. Players want the flexibility to gamble anytime, anywhere, and casinos are responding accordingly. Expect to see even more mobile-optimized games, with intuitive interfaces, seamless gameplay, and features designed specifically for mobile devices. This includes things like touch-screen controls, portrait mode options, and push notifications to keep you informed of new promotions and game releases. The best online casinos will prioritize a flawless mobile experience, ensuring that you can enjoy your favourite games on your smartphone or tablet without any compromises.
The Growth of Mobile-First Casinos
This trend goes beyond just optimizing existing games for mobile. We’re seeing the emergence of mobile-first casinos, which are designed from the ground up with mobile users in mind. These casinos often have streamlined interfaces, simplified navigation, and a focus on games that are ideally suited for mobile play. They understand that the mobile experience is different from the desktop experience, and they’re tailoring their offerings accordingly. This means faster loading times, more responsive designs, and a greater emphasis on convenience and ease of use.
Cryptocurrency and Blockchain: A New Frontier
C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um are making their mark on the online casino industry. They offer several advantages, including faster transactions, increased anonymity, and lower fees. Blockchain technology, which underpins cryptocurrencies, also provides enhanced security and transparency, making it more difficult for casinos to manipulate games or engage in fraudulent activities. While the use of crypto in online gambling is still relatively new, it’s growing rapidly. Expect to see more casinos accepting cryptocurrencies and exploring the potential of blockchain technology to improve the overall player experience.
Decentralized Casinos: The Future of Trust?
One exciting development is the rise of decentralized casinos, which operate on blockchain technology and eliminate the need for a central authority. These casinos use smart contracts to automate payouts, ensuring fairness and transparency. Players can verify the results of each game, knowing that the outcome is truly random and not subject to manipulation. While decentralized casinos are still a niche market, they have the potential to disrupt the industry by offering a more secure and trustworthy gambling experience.
Responsible Gambling: A Priority for the Future
The online casino industry is under increasing pressure to promote responsible gambling. This means implementing measures to protect vulnerable players and prevent problem gambling. Expect to see more casinos investing in tools and features that help players manage their spending, set limits, and take breaks. This includes things like de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and access to resources for problem gamblers. The best online casinos will prioritize responsible gambling, not only because it’s the right thing to do, but also because it’s essential for the long-term sustainability of the industry.
AI and Machine Learning: Personalizing the Experience
Art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ning are being used to personalize the gambling experience. Casinos are using AI algorithms to analyze player data, identify patterns, and tailor their offerings accordingly. This includes things like recommending games based on your preferences, offering personalized bonuses and promotions, and providing targeted support to players who may be at risk of developing a gambling problem. AI is also being used to detect and prevent fraud, ensuring a safer and more secure gambling environment.
